How the Match-Bonus Mechanism Works

A match bonus multiplies your first deposit by a set percentage, up to a fixed cap. You deposit £50, the casino adds 100% – you play with £100. But the bonus funds sit in a separate balance until you satisfy wagering requirements. The crucial number is not the percentage but the combination of cap and wagering multiplier. A 200% offer capped at £50 sounds generous, but if the wagering is 60x, the real turnover obligation is £3,000. The headline number is just the starting point.

With Skrill deposits, the payment processor’s speed means funds land in your account instantly, and withdrawals back to Skrill are typically processed within 24 hours. The trade-off is that some operators treat e-wallet deposits differently for bonus eligibility. Always check the promotion’s terms for the specific line “Skrill deposits qualify” – if it is absent, assume it does not. Our picks below are vetted for explicit Skrill inclusion. Wagering Requirements: The Arithmetic Behind the Offer

Take a typical welcome offer: 100% match up to £100 with 35x wagering on the bonus amount. You deposit £50, receive £50 in bonus funds. The wagering requirement is £50 × 35 = £1,750 in total stakes before you can withdraw any winnings derived from the bonus. This turnover must be met within a set period, commonly 30 days. If you play only slots that contribute 100%, every pound staked counts. If you dabble in table games, which often contribute 10% or less, the required turnover effectively multiplies.

Here is the hard truth: a 200% bonus with 50x wagering on the total (deposit + bonus) is often a worse deal than a 100% bonus with 30x wagering on the bonus only. The total wagering figure is what matters. Game Weighting and Maximum Bet Rules

Not all games count equally toward wagering. Slot machines typically contribute 100%, while table games like blackjack and roulette contribute 5–20% or even zero. This weighting is a deliberate design: slots have a higher house edge, so the casino recoups the bonus cost faster. If you prefer blackjack, a 10% contribution means you must wager ten times more than the stated requirement to clear the bonus.

Equally important is the maximum bet rule while wagering. Most terms cap your stake at £5 per spin or hand when playing with active bonus funds. Exceed that even once, and the operator voids the bonus and any associated winnings. This is the most common accidental breach – a player spins at £6 on a high-volatility slot and loses the entire promotional balance. The rule exists to prevent bonus abuse, but it catches unwary players daily. Stick to £4.99 or lower until the wagering is cleared.

When a Bigger Percentage Is Worse: A Worked Comparison

Consider two market-typical offers from established operators:

Offer A: 100% match up to £50, 30x wagering on the bonus, slots contribute 100%, max bet £5.

Offer B: 200% match up to £100, 50x wagering on the bonus + deposit, max bet £5.

Deposit £50 in both. Offer A gives £50 bonus, total wagering = £50 × 30 = £1,500. Offer B gives £100 bonus, total balance £150, wagering = £150 × 50 = £7,500. Offer B requires five times more turnover to unlock the same withdrawal potential. The bigger percentage is mathematically worse unless you intend to play through £7,500 in stakes anyway. For the casual player, Offer A is the superior choice. The cap and wagering interplay always trumps the headline percentage.

Claiming the Offer, Opt-In Pitfalls, and Payment-Method Exclusions

Claiming a Skrill casino welcome bonus requires three steps: register an account, navigate to the promotions page, and opt in before making the deposit. Many players skip the opt-in step and then wonder why the bonus never arrived. Opt-in can be a simple toggle, a bonus code entry, or a checkbox during deposit. Some operators require you to contact customer support to activate the offer. Read the “How to claim” section of the terms – it is the single most overlooked paragraph.

Payment-method exclusions are the second trap. Some operators explicitly exclude e-wallets like Skrill from their welcome offer, pushing players toward debit cards. Our selected brands all accept Skrill for the welcome bonus, but even among these, the minimum deposit may differ for e-wallet users. A typical minimum deposit is £10, but check the specific promotion page for any variance.

Expiry periods are short. Most welcome bonuses expire 7–14 days after the deposit is made. If you do not meet the wagering within that window, the bonus and any winnings are forfeit. Set a calendar reminder or plan your sessions accordingly. The practicalities are summarised below.

Safer Gambling: Keep It Entertainment

All gambling carries risk, and bonuses are designed to extend play, not guarantee profit. Decide on a deposit ceiling before you begin, and view any bonus as a chance to explore games you enjoy, not a route to earnings. If you feel the urge to chase losses or spend more than intended, GambleAware offers free support at BeGambleAware.org, and GAMSTOP (gamstop.co.uk) can block access to all UKGC-licensed sites. When can I withdraw the bonus itself?

The bonus funds are not cashable; they are a credit for play. Only winnings that result from meeting the wagering requirement can be withdrawn. Any leftover bonus balance after wagering is typically removed from your account.

Why is the maximum bet rule so strict?

Operators impose a max bet rule to prevent players from placing large, high-variance bets that could clear wagering too quickly or exploit the bonus structure. Exceeding the limit, even by accident, voids the bonus and winnings. Always check the maximum stake per spin or hand in the terms.

Can I use the bonus on any game?

No. Game weighting applies: slots count 100%, but table games, live dealer, and video poker contribute far less or nothing. If your favourite game is excluded, the bonus is not worth claiming. Check the contribution list on the promotion page before you begin.
